Berg Enterprises, Inc., based in southern Arizona, has built residential and commercial air solutions since 1974. Family-owned and operated, Berg's provides turnkey HVAC, mechanical, plumbing & pipefitting services in select federal and commercial markets across the Southwestern United States and other federal installations. This includes site analysis, engineering design, procurement, installation, program management, and O&M services.

Tyler Johnston is the Chief Executive Officer of Berg Enterprises, Inc, a family-owned company providing turnkey HVAC, mechanical, plumbing & pipefitting services in select commercial and federal markets. Tyler is responsible for setting and driving the strategic direction of the firm and managing relationships with external stakeholders.

Prior to that, he developed distributed energy and infrastructure partnerships at Black & Veatch (BV) across commercial and industrial markets. He also collaborated with project developers, SaaS providers, and various forms of capital to bring to market new projects and technologies to accelerate revenue for BV’s partner consortium and reduce greenhouse gas emissions.

Tyler has spent the past decade working in business development roles across energy and tech. He has also held client-facing roles at NRG Energy and General Electric, where he developed and executed distributed energy deals with Fortune 500 clients across the US & EU.

Tyler began his career as an infantry officer in the United States Marine Corps, where he led combat operations in Iraq and Afghanistan. He holds a BS from the United States Naval Academy and an MBA from Columbia Business School.
